How did NAACP fight segregation

Social Studies
1 answer:
Lilit [14]3 years ago
4 0

Answer: The NAACP played a pivotal role in the civil rights movement of the 1950s and 1960s. One of the organization's key victories was the U.S. Supreme Court's 1954 decision in Brown v. Board of Education that outlawed segregation in public schools.

What did the Minoans and Mycenaeans have in common?
3241004551 [841]

Answer:

They both traded with other societies, influenced Greek culture, and used the sea for travel.
